Maintenance Technician Jobs in Utah
A Maintenance Technician in the hospitality service industry is responsible for carrying out various maintenance tasks to ensure the smooth operation of the facility, which can include hotels, resorts, or other hospitality venues. These technicians are vital in maintaining the overall appearance and functionality of the property, performing regular inspections, and addressing any maintenance issues promptly. Duties can range from simple tasks like changing light bulbs, to more complex tasks like plumbing and electrical repairs, painting and decorating rooms, or even maintaining the heating and cooling systems. They also conduct regular preventive maintenance to avoid potential issues and ensure guest satisfaction.
Important skills for a Maintenance Technician include problem-solving, attention to detail, and both verbal and written communication skills. Manual dexterity and physical stamina are also essential, as the role involves a lot of physical work. Knowledge of various maintenance tasks, such as electrical systems, plumbing, carpentry, and HVAC systems, is crucial. Certifications in these areas, along with a high school diploma or equivalent, are typically required. They should also have a strong understanding of safety procedures and regulations. Prior to becoming a Maintenance Technician, a person might have roles such as a Maintenance Assistant, Handyman, or even a Custodial Worker, where they can gain relevant experience in maintenance tasks and procedures.
